Struct PoolConstraints 

Source
pub struct PoolConstraints { /* private fields */ }
Expand description

Connection pool constraints.

This type stores min and max constraints for crate::Pool and ensures that min <= max.

impl PoolConstraints

Source

pub const fn new(min: usize, max: usize) -> Option<PoolConstraints>

Creates new PoolConstraints if constraints are valid (min <= max).

§Connection URL

You can use pool_min and pool_max URL parameters to define pool constraints.

let opts = Opts::from_url("mysql://localhost/db?pool_min=0&pool_max=151")?;
assert_eq!(opts.pool_opts().constraints(), PoolConstraints::new(0, 151).unwrap());
Source

pub fn min(&self) -> usize

Lower bound of this pool constraints.

Source

pub fn max(&self) -> usize

Upper bound of this pool constraints.
